I just updated JAVASERVERFACES_SPEC_PUBLIC-1066 with some suggested JavaDoc for Application.getNavigationHandler() based on the JavaDoc from Application.getResourceHandler().

When I created the issue back in 2012, I became aware of the JavaDoc oversight in getNavigationHandler() because I had to implement a NavigationHandler for the JSF Portlet Bridge. I was not aware of the oversight in other methods like getMessageBundle(), etc. as Bauke mentions below.

> Well, there are more missing. E.g. getMessageBundle() doesn't mention <application><message-bundle>, getResourceBundle() doesn't mention <application><resource-bundle>, getDefaultRenderKitId() doesn't mention <application><default-render-kit-id>, getActionListener() doesn't mention <application><action-listener>.
>
> I agree we should align out the javadoc as much as possible, but I wonder why the user was mentioning only the navigation handler.
